Titel | Level and Rate of Desegregation and White Enrollment Decline in a Big City School System |

Abstract | "White flight" from desegregated schools is most likely to occur in city districts with a high proportion of minority students surrounded by largely white suburbs. Enrollment data from 1956 to 1974 for the Kansas City, Missouri Public Schools indicates that white enrollment decline tended to accelerate in schools with many black students and/or a recent rapid increase in black students.
